What are Gemini and Perplexity?

On the surface, they look similar. You type in a question, you get an answer. But if you peek under the hood, you’ll see they have very different philosophies.

Google Gemini explained

Think of Gemini as Google's all-in-one creative partner. It’s designed to be a conversational sidekick that can help you brainstorm, write, and even analyze images. Its biggest advantage is being plugged directly into the Google universe, so it works hand-in-hand with tools like Docs, Sheets, and Gmail. If you need to come up with something new, whether it's an email draft or a marketing slogan, Gemini is your go-to. It’s the "Creative Generalist" in the room.

Perplexity AI explained

Perplexity, on the other hand, calls itself an "answer engine." It’s less of a creative partner and more of a super-powered researcher. Its whole mission is to give you accurate, up-to-date answers with a clear list of sources. It shows you its work, linking directly to the articles and reports it used to formulate a response. This makes it an amazing tool for fact-checking, research, or just getting a trustworthy summary on any topic. It’s the "Factual Researcher" you can rely on.

A feature-by-feature comparison

This is where you really start to see the two AIs diverge. Their core functions highlight their different strengths and, for business use, their different weaknesses.

Information accuracy and sourcing

Perplexity is the clear winner here. Its main selling point is its commitment to transparent sourcing. When you ask a question, it doesn't just give you an answer; it gives you footnotes with links to the exact web pages where it found the information. If you're writing a report or need to verify a statistic, this is unbelievably helpful. You get the answer and the proof.

Gemini can pull from the web, but it often leans heavily on the massive amount of data it was trained on. This means its information can sometimes be a bit dated or less specific. It does provide some links, but it’s not as thorough or central to its identity as it is for Perplexity. For casual questions, it’s fine. For serious research, you might find yourself double-checking its work.

Creative generation vs. factual synthesis

Gemini is built for creation. It excels at generating new text, brainstorming ideas for a marketing campaign, or even helping you write a poem. Because it’s multimodal, it can also interpret images and generate content based on them. If you’re starting with a blank page and need a creative spark, Gemini is the better choice.

Perplexity is more of a synthesizer. It’s brilliant at finding existing information from multiple sources and weaving it together into a neat, easy-to-read summary. It’s not trying to invent anything new; it’s trying to give you the most accurate and concise summary of what the world already knows.

Ecosystem and workflow integration

Gemini has a huge home-field advantage here. Being a Google product, it's woven directly into Google Workspace. You can summon Gemini inside a Google Doc to help you write, use it in Gmail to draft replies, or get its help in Sheets to analyze data. For anyone living in the Google ecosystem, this is a massive productivity boost.

Perplexity is more of a solo act. It’s a destination you go to for research. While you can make it your default search engine, it doesn't plug into other apps in a meaningful way. It lives in its own tab, waiting for you to ask it a question.

Pricing and plans: A transparent breakdown

The way these tools are priced tells you a lot about who they're for. They’re built and sold for individuals, not for entire teams that need to scale.

Gemini pricing

  • Free Tier: You get access to the standard Gemini model, which is great for everyday use.

  • Gemini Advanced: This is part of the Google One AI Premium plan for $19.99/month. It gets you access to Google's top-tier models, deeper integrations with Workspace, and a hefty 2TB of cloud storage.

Perplexity pricing

  • Free Tier: Offers a solid experience but limits how many "Pro" searches (which use more advanced models) you can do per day.

  • Perplexity Pro: For $20/month, you get over 300 Pro searches daily, the ability to pick different AI models like GPT-4, and the option to upload your own files for analysis.
